Bathroom design ideas for 2017



homes remodeling

You may be searching for the hottest bathrooms. This article will discuss the key elements that make trend bathrooms stand out from others. Freestanding tubs are a popular trend for 2017. A tub with a smooth, white surface is featured in the Westin Preston III model home. Its faucet is side-mounted, letting the tub's smooth surface be the focus. This bathroom features a variety of trendy bathroom elements, including bold subway-style wall tiles and luxurious lighting.

Bathrooms are getting a fresh look with their new functionality. To enhance harmony and comfort, bathrooms take advantage of their prime spots in a house. Large-format tiles are replacing small mosaic tiles which were very popular only a few short years ago. These large-format tiles work well with a range of decor themes. They can be used to cover the floors or walls. These tiles can be used in combination with stone-look products or to make a statement. Alternatively, you can combine a patterned tile with a natural stone-look material like travertine.

Marble is an attractive and modern addition to a bathroom. Recently, white marble has become a popular trend. The classic appeal of white marble has made it a popular choice to decorate bathrooms. Marble tiles combined with grey can create an amazing visual and tactile effect. Whether you're going for a traditional white marble bathroom or a contemporary one, there's a marble-inspired bathroom to fit the trend perfectly.


The bold use of colors on the lower half of bathroom walls is one of the most popular trends for 2017. For an added touch of warmth, you can add a brighter color to the ceiling. Color blocking is also another on-trend technique that is sure to add a touch of luxury to any bathroom. Be sure to keep the space from looking too similar by using natural breaks between colors. You don’t always have to keep it the same. Change it!

For large spaces, you can use paneling, paint, or tiles to break them up. You can add color to small bathrooms with tiles. They look great in combination of deep blues and blacks. Combining floor tiles and wall tile creates a striking statement in the bathroom. It also adds character. Split walls can be used if you like wallpaper. This creates a focal point in your bathroom and adds interest.

The trendiest homeowners are choosing darker interiors. Grey has been popular for the past two years, but black bathrooms are predicted to become popular in 2020. You won't feel as comfortable in the kitchen and living room if you use darker, more dramatic tones. Bold colors can be used in the bathroom because it is less intimidating. How do I choose the right contractor?

Ask your family and friends for recommendations when choosing a contractor. Also, look at online reviews. Look online for reviews to ensure the contractor you choose is experienced in the construction area you are interested. Check out references and ask for them to provide you with some.
